A while back I bought an adapter to fill my SodaStream tank using the #10 co2 tank for my kegerator. It's been working great mostly, except when my #10 tanks goes below #3. When it's under #3, I can only get the SodaStream tank to take about 100g of co2.

Here's my fill process..
I freeze the SodaStream tank for 30 min. Then I connect SodaStream tank to #10 tank using the adapter and flip it upsidedown. I slowly open the valve until I can't hear the CO2 filling anymore. Then I weigh it to see how full it is.

Does anyone know why this is happening or know how to fix it? I'm guessing the pressure in my #10 tank is too low, but it continues working fine in the kegerator. I only have a single gauge regulator, so I don't know what the high side pressure is. Thanks!

How do you determine how much CO2 is left in the tank? With liquid CO2 pressure will remain constant (dependent on temperature) until all liquid is exhausted and only gas remains. Perhaps your tank is in this condition and you're only equalizing pressure between the two tanks and only transferring gas and not liquid?

My buddy in TN refills those sodastream bottles. He buys a bunch empty on Craigslist. Goes down to local grocery store and gets a piece of dry ice (solid frozen co2). Takes the valve right off a bunch of bottles. Lines them up. Uses some oven gloves and puts a chunk of ice in a clean folded towel. Smashes it up with a hammer. Gets a little scale and measures out the grams of co2 the bottle will hold. Pours that amount down the neck of bottle and reseals the valve on top. Says he adds just a little more because their is some loss, less if you put the empty bottles in freezer first. He has quite a following with people dropping off empties and he fills them much cheaper than sodastream charges. Never had an issue. I use 2L PET coke bottles with a carbonation cap (gas post QD connecrion) to make seltzer when my 5KG bottle gets too low to refill soda stream canisters. I set the reg to 50psi - PET coke bottles start failing at ~150psi so a good margin there. 30 seconds shake and you're good to go if the waters cold. If I hadn't come across a $5 brand-new-second-hand soda stream I'd still be making all my seltzer this way.

5kg CO2 gets me about 10x 250g refills and half a dozen 19L kegs carbed & lots of miscellaneous use but the weights taper off a bit. COMPLETELY releasing all the CO2 then freezing the bottles before you connect and fill them makes a big difference. I usually get them to within 10% of the fill weight (under) but getting them really fill doesn't matter to me. If I don't have them completely inverted as the flow starts when the large tank gets low I can end up with a pretty light canister.

Regular co2 tanks and SodaStream tanks have different threads. The monkemon adapter eliminates the SodaStream tank completely. The black side connects to the SodaStream machine in place of the tank. The brass side connects to a standard co2 tank.

Once they stop working in the soda stream, its easy to depress the canisters stop-valve with the handle of a spoon. If there's still high pressure inside you'll struggle to do this; it should be less pressure than you need to squash a tomatoe. It'll hiss for a few seconds.

I'm not sure if freezing the canisters for 15mins or so causes a slight vacuum that helps, or if the stop-valve allows O2 to suck inwards - or both. I haven't used my refills to carb kegs but it may be a potential source of oxidation. Others may know this for sure.

I'm tempted to use 250g canisters & reg adapter to finish carbing just to reduce the chances of a CO2 leak smashing out a new 5kg bottle... it really sucks and if this hasn't happened for you yet, chances are its just a matter of time!

Also, when you're making seltzer in a coke bottle it helps to squish the bottle to take the air out before you put the cap on. This way once you turn the CO2 on and the bottle pops out there's a mouthful of CO2 at the top to shake into high surface-area bubbles, rather than a mix of mostly air. You'll notice every time you shake, the CO2 flows again.
